How Tusilin LS Syrup works:

Ambroxol, levosalbutamol, and guaifenesin combine in Tusilin LS Syrup to alleviate coughs productive of phlegm.

FAQs on Tusilin LS Syrup

Tusilin LS Syrup combines ambroxol, levosalbutamol/levalbuterol, and guaifenesin to treat coughs with mucus. Ambroxol, a mucolytic, thins phlegm for easier expectoration. Levosalbutamol, a bronchodilator, relaxes airway muscles to widen breathing passages. Guaifenesin, an expectorant, reduces phlegm stickiness, facilitating its removal.
Tusilin LS Syrup is generally safe, but some users may experience side effects such as n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, stomach pain, allergic reactions, dizziness, headache, rash, hives, tremor, palpitations, muscle cramps, and increased heart rate. Report any persistent issues to your doctor.
Patients allergic to any component of Tusilin LS Syrup should avoid its use. Concurrent use of levosalbutamol and beta-blockers, such as propranolol, is generally inadvisable.
Dizziness, including faintness, weakness, unsteadiness, or lightheadedness, is a possible side effect of Tusilin LS Syrup. Rest is advised if dizziness occurs; avoid driving or operating machinery until symptoms subside.
Diarrhea is a possible side effect of Tusilin LS Syrup. If you experience diarrhea, increase your fluid intake. Consult your doctor if diarrhea continues or you show signs of dehydration, such as decreased urination and dark, strong-smelling urine. Do not self-medicate.
